Detailed explanation-1: -Animals that are carnivores (and some omnivores) must hunt their food. These hunters are called predators, and the animals or insects they hunt are called prey. Predator-prey relationships are important parts of the food chain. Animals that are carnivores (and some omnivores) must hunt their food.
Detailed explanation-2: -A carnivorous animal that hunts other animals is called a predator; an animal that is hunted is called prey.
Detailed explanation-3: -Predation is a biological interaction where one organism, the predator, kills and eats another organism, its prey.
